Thank you. About your question, when we feel a post has crossed the line & has to be deleted, we have the option of doing a 'discreet delete' or a 'complete delete'. A discreet delete leaves the title & poster's name intact but when you open it the post you see a message that reads, Sorry for the inconvenience. This post has been moved or deleted. With a complete delete, all traces of the post are gone.

Re: the posts in question, I chose to delete them completely since ToC often embedded his offensive messages right in the titles themselves. If I'd gone in & deleted the message readers would still have been left with the title. In fact, sometimes all ToC posted was a title with no message.

If an offensive post generates intelligent rebuttals, I may do a discreet delete on the offensive post & leave the following discussion. But since that leaves readers not knowing what the original offensive wording was, that's usually not the best solution. But when posts are nonsensical or simply initiate angry responses, I opt to delete them completely.
